To answer your question, there is no agency requirement for
what you're trying to test. *Both input and output are not
covered by the low voltage directive because they're both
unsafe to touch. *So the only requirement is operational
insulation which your test proved.
I also failed to mention that Most standards allow for DC
testing at 1.414 times the AC voltage required.
